Component sensor and method for the contactless measurement of the components of static and dynamic forces on metallic specimens, in particular shafts, pipes or plates, in which on the basis of application of complex forces, e.g. simultaneously occurring tensile and torsional forces, a quasi two-dimensional joint extension or compression which leads to permeability changes in the specimen occurs in the material. On the basis of the design according to the invention of the sensor head, the permeability changes occurring in the specimen are decomposed into two or three components, so that the forces acting can be detected in terms of their direction of action and magnitude. It is thus possible, for example, given appropriate angular alignment of the component sensor to measure separately from one another the tensile forces and torques acting on a linkage. |
